Web(kăt′ər-kôr′nərd, kăt′ē-) also cat·er-cor·ner (-nər) or cat·ty-cor·nered or cat·ty-cor·ner (kăt′ē-) or kit·ty-cor·nered or kit·ty-cor·ner (kĭt′ē-) adj. Diagonal. adv. In a diagonal position. [From obsolete cater, four at dice, from Middle English, from Old French catre, four, from Latin quattuor; see k w etwer- in Indo-European roots .] WebDefine kitty-cornered. kitty-cornered synonyms, kitty-cornered pronunciation, kitty-cornered translation, English dictionary definition of kitty-cornered. or kit·ty-cor·ner adj. & adv. Variants of cater-cornered.

Webcatty-corner. or kitty-corner. adverb. Something that is catty-corner or kitty-corner from another thing is placed or arranged diagonally from it. [US] There was a police car catty-corner across the street. ...two 50-foot-tall, steel and aluminum towers standing kitty-corner from each other. Collins COBUILD Advanced Learner’s Dictionary. WebApr 25, 2014 · The word “kitty-corner” has many different variations: catty-corner, caddy-corner, cat-a-corner, or kit-a-corner. They all mean the same thing: something that is directionally diagonal from a certain point. …
Webkitty-corner In a diagonal position from, especially outward from the corner of a square.
